Requirement for valid real estate contract

Which of the following is not a requirement for a valid real estate contract:

  1.   It must be witnessed
  2.   It must be unilateral
  3.   There must be sufficient consideration
  4.   none of the above

The answer is B.  A real estate contract does not have to be unilateral – in fact, most are bilateral.